Ingredients You’ll Need
You likely have most of these items in your kitchen already. They are simple pantry staples that create big flavor.
- 1.5 lbs boneless skinless chicken breast, cut into 1-inch cubes
- 2 cups fresh broccoli florets
- 1 cup low-fat cottage cheese
- 0.5 cup plain non-fat Greek yogurt
- 1 cup shredded sharp cheddar cheese
- 1 tsp garlic powder
- 1 tsp onion powder
- 0.5 tsp smoked paprika
- 0.5 tsp kosher salt
- 0.25 tsp ground black pepper
Step-by-Step Directions
-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C) and lightly grease a 9×13 inch baking dish.
- In a blender, combine cottage cheese, yogurt,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per.
- Process until the mixture is completely smooth and creamy.
- Place the cubed chicken and broccoli florets into the baking dish.
- Pour the blended sauce over the chicken and broccoli.
- Toss gently to ensure all pieces are well coated.
- Distribute the shredded cheddar cheese evenly over the top.
- Sprinkle with smoked paprika for a hint of color and warmth.
- Bake for 25 to 30 minutes until the chicken is cooked through.
- Allow the dish to rest for 5 minutes before serving.

Storage & Reheating
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ge. They will stay fresh for up to four days. This makes it a perfect meal prep option for busy weeks. Reheat in the microwave or oven until warmed through. The sauce stays creamy and delicious even after reheating.
Tips for Best Results
- Blend the sauce until it is silky and smooth.
- Cut your chicken into even cubes for consistent cooking.
- Use fresh broccoli for the best tender-crisp texture.
- Do not skip the resting time to let the sauce set.
- For a healthy reset, serve with a side of greens.
- Pat the chicken dry before adding it to the dish.
- Grate your own cheese for a better melt.
Ways to Switch It Up
- Swap broccoli for cauliflower florets for a different flavor.
- Use pepper jack cheese if you want a little heat.
- Add a handful of sliced mushrooms for extra earthiness.
- In summer, try using zucchini instead of broccoli.
Common Questions
Can I use frozen broccoli?
Yes, you can use frozen broccoli. Just make sure to thaw and pat it dry first. This prevents the sauce from becoming too watery during baking.
Will it taste like cottage cheese?
Not at all. Once blended and baked, it becomes a smooth, savory sauce. It just tastes like a rich and creamy cheese sauce.
